Ti-Ti-Pu: A Boy of Red River by J. Macdonald Oxley is an engaging adventure novel set in the rugged wilderness of Canada's Red River region. The story follows the exploits of a young boy named Ti-Ti-Pu, whose experiences reflect the challenges and triumphs of life in this remote area during the early 19th century. Ti-Ti-Pu, the protagonist, is a spirited and resourceful boy who embodies the resilience and ingenuity necessary for survival in the wild. The narrative begins by introducing Ti-Ti-Pu's family and their way of life, which is deeply intertwined with the natural environment. Ti-Ti-Pu's parents are hardworking and loving, instilling in him the values of perseverance and respect for nature. As the story unfolds, Ti-Ti-Pu embarks on a series of adventures that test his courage and skills. These adventures are not just physical challenges but also rites of passage that contribute to his personal growth. From hunting expeditions to encounters with wild animals, Ti-Ti-Pu faces numerous trials that push him to his limits. Oxley vividly describes these adventures, bringing the Red River landscape to life with rich and detailed prose. One of the central themes of the novel is the relationship between humans and nature. Ti-Ti-Pu's life is deeply connected to the natural world, and his survival depends on his ability to understand and respect the environment. This theme is explored through Ti-Ti-Pu's interactions with the wildlife and the land, as well as through the traditional knowledge passed down by his family. Oxley highlights the importance of living in harmony with nature, a message that resonates throughout the story. The novel also delves into the cultural heritage of the Red River region. Through Ti-Ti-Pu's experiences, readers gain insight into the customs and traditions of the indigenous people of the area. Oxley portrays these cultural elements with sensitivity and respect, emphasizing their significance in Ti-Ti-Pu's identity and way of life. The portrayal of the community's customs, rituals, and social structures adds depth to the narrative and enriches the reader's understanding of Ti-Ti-Pu's world. Friendship and loyalty are key themes in Ti-Ti-Pu: A Boy of Red River. Ti-Ti-Pu forms close bonds with other characters in the story, including both humans and animals. These relationships are essential to his development and survival, providing support and companionship in the face of adversity. The theme of loyalty is particularly prominent, as Ti-Ti-Pu learns the value of trust and cooperation in overcoming challenges. The novel's setting plays a crucial role in shaping the narrative. The Red River region, with its vast forests, rivers, and wildlife, serves as both a backdrop and a character in its own right. Oxley's descriptions of the landscape are vivid and immersive, capturing the beauty and harshness of the wilderness. This setting not only provides the context for Ti-Ti-Pu's adventures but also underscores the themes of survival and resilience. Overall, Ti-Ti-Pu: A Boy of Red River by J. Macdonald Oxley is a captivating adventure novel that offers readers a glimpse into the life of a young boy in the Red River region. Through Ti-Ti-Pu's experiences, Oxley explores themes of survival, nature, cultural heritage, and friendship. The novel's rich descriptions and engaging narrative make it a timeless story of adventure and personal growth. Readers of all ages will find inspiration in Ti-Ti-Pu's resilience and resourcefulness as he navigates the challenges of his environment and discovers his place in the world.

In this firsthand account of his missionary enterprise during a severe food shortage, the smallpox epidemic, the MZtis resistance at Fort Garry, and recurrent tribal warfare in the turbulent 1860s and1870s, McDougall chronicles what may have been the end of the innocence in the Canadian Northwest.

Excerpt from In the Days of the Red River Rebellion: Life and Adventure in the Far West of Canada (1868-1872) Excepting my own family, our party is entirely tenderfoot. The Rev. Peter Campbell and wife and children are with us, also Mr. A. I. Snider, who has come out as teacher, and a sturdy Scotchman with his Red River native wife; these latter going with us to Pigeon Lake, and Messrs, Campbell and Snider to Edmonton. Even in a small party of tenderfeet there is striking variety in point of vision. As we gather around the camp-fires we listen and hear such talk as this: Oh, what a big country! Months of constant travel, and it is still before us! Room for millions! Splendid soil! Rich grass! What glorious landscapes!
